ITA Airways is Italy's national flag carrier, established in 2020 as the successor to Alitalia. Co-owned by the Italian Ministry of Economy and Finance and Lufthansa Group, it operates a modern, predominantly Airbus fleet. ITA Airways serves over 70 domestic, European, and intercontinental destinations, with its main hub at Rome Fiumicino Airport. The airline offers Economy, Premium Economy, and Business Class, with complimentary meals and in-flight Wi-Fi on many routes. ITA Airways was a SkyTeam member until April 2025 and is expected to join Star Alliance in the first half of 2026.

Air Dolomiti is an Italian regional airline,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Lufthansa, and a member of Lufthansa Regional. Established in 1989, it began operations in 1991 with the goal of connecting smaller Italian cities to the rest of Europe.The airline primarily operates routes from various Italian destinations to and from Lufthansa's main hubs in Munich and Frankfurt, Germany. As of August 2025, Air Dolomiti serves 26 destinations in Italy and other European countries. Its fleet, which has evolved over the years to include Embraer 190 and 195 aircraft, is known for its focus on passenger comfort and Italian elegance in its inflight service.

AirBaltic is the flag carrier of Latvia and a leading hybrid airline in the Baltics, combining aspects of traditional network and low-cost carriers. Founded in 1995, it operates a modern fleet of Airbus A220-300 aircraft, connecting the Baltics from hubs in Riga, Tallinn, Vilnius, and Tampere to over 70 destinations across Europe, the Middle East, North Africa, and the Caucasus. The company is majority-owned by the Latvian state. AirBaltic is recognized for its commitment to passenger experience, having received awards for cabin service and being among the world's safest airlines. In a pioneering move, AirBaltic became the first European airline to offer free high-speed SpaceX Starlink internet on its flights in February 2025.

LOT Polish Airlines, legally Polskie Linie Lotnicze LOT S.A., is the flag carrier of Poland and one of the world's oldest airlines, founded in 1928. It is a founding member of IATA and joined the Star Alliance in 2003. With its main hub at Warsaw Chopin Airport, LOT serves over 97 destinations across Europe, Asia, and North America with a fleet of 87 aircraft as of June 2025. The airline is recognized for operating one of Europe's youngest fleets and was the first European operator of the Boeing 787 Dreamliner.

Helvetic Airways is a Swiss regional airline established in 2003, headquartered in Kloten with its fleet stationed at Zurich Airport. It operates short and medium-haul flights to European and North African destinations, focusing on leisure markets not served by other carriers. Helvetic Airways also conducts scheduled flights on behalf of Swiss International Air Lines and Lufthansa. The airline is known for its modern, environmentally friendly fleet, primarily consisting of Embraer E-Jet aircraft, and emphasizes Swiss quality, efficiency, punctuality, and customer service.

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
